Abstract
- das in dem Rankine-Kreislauf zirkulierende Arbeitsmittel vor dem Wärmetausch mit einem externen Medium auf einen Druck oberhalb seines kritischen Drucks gepumpt,
- im Wärmetausch mit dem externen Medium auf eine Temperatur oberhalb seiner kritischen Temperatur angewärmt wird, wobei die Temperatur wenigstens so hoch ist, dass das Arbeitsmittel ohne teilzukondensieren entspannt werden kann,
- das Arbeitsmittel entspannt und das entspannte Arbeitsmittel kondensiert wird.
